As noted, there are often plenty of legal places where you can camp for free or for very little money, including municipal parks and fairgrounds. Some of these places even have showers and flush toilets. There are also some cyclist-only facilities that have sprung up. Twin Bridges, MT, Dalbo, MN and Winthrop, WA come to mind. I also remember reading about a couple who established one near Republic, WA. Not sure if it's still around.
